Meeting of foreign ministers of Sahel countries will convene in early December in Nouakchott (Mr. Messahel)

Ministry for Foreign Affairs – November 13, 2011
A meeting of the ministers for Foreign Affairs of the Sahel countries (Algeria, Mali, Mauritania and Niger) will be convene in early December in Nouakchott, said Minister Delegate for Maghreb and African Affairs Abdelkader Messahel, speaking in Algiers on November 12.

 

Mr. Messahel says Washington meeting between the U.S. and the Countries of the Sahel Zone is “qualitative step” in partnership

Ministry for Foreign Affairs – November 8, 2011

The meeting convened in Washington between the United States and the countries of the zone (Algeria, Mali, Mauritania and Niger) is “a qualitative step” in the implementation of a partnership, as envisioned at the Algiers counterterrorism conference, said Minister Delegate for Maghreb and African Affairs Abdelkader Messahel in a statement to APS.

 

Meeting between Mr. Benjamin, Mr. Messahel and the Foreign Affairs ministers of the other countries of the Sahel region

Ministry for Foreign Affairs – November 7, 2011

U.S. State Department’s Coordinator for Counterterrorism Daniel Benjamin met on November 7 in Washington with Minister Delegate for Maghreb and African Affairs Abdelkader Messahel and the Ministers for Foreign Affairs of Mali, Mauritania and Niger.

 

Algeria does not pay ransoms and firmly condemns that practice (Ministry for Foreign Affairs)

Algérie Presse Service (APS) – November 4, 2011

“Algeria does not pay ransoms and firmly condemns that practice, be it by States or public or private organizations,” the spokesman for the ministry for Foreign Affairs, Mr. Amar Belani, reiterated in a statement issued today in Algiers.
